Summary

The C120 is a mainline industrial silo and a strong default choice when the project has moved firmly into higher-throughput operation. At this level, storage becomes substantial enough that operator involvement drops sharply and the silo begins to support bigger strategic aims, including larger boilers and future ORC-linked systems.

This is no longer small or mid-range storage. It is serious industrial capacity.

Why Choose C120

The C120 is attractive because it combines:

  • significant storage volume
  • high system autonomy
  • a form factor that fits many larger industrial projects without immediately stepping into the very largest structures

For many sites, it is the point where storage becomes a dependable part of wider plant infrastructure rather than a daily handling aid.

Typical Context

This model is a strong fit for:

  • larger boiler systems
  • M-range-adjacent applications
  • higher-throughput manufacturing sites
  • projects where ORC integration is being considered as part of the broader energy picture
Operational Effect

At this level, fuel handling should feel like background infrastructure. That is the value of the C120: it gives the plant operational headroom and storage confidence without immediately moving into the very largest 6m energy-centre class.
